Tens of thousands of Israelis demonstrated again across the country against the government’s plan to restrict the powers of the Supreme Court.
This is the 11th week of mass protests, as opponents of the reforms accuse right-wing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u of undermining judicial independence.
Mr Netanyahu, who is on trial for corruption, said his aim was to restore a balance of power between the government and Israel’s highest court.
Escalating protests have impacted the economy and prompted some military reservists to threaten to defy call-up orders.
